Default Egg Salad Blahs

I just took 3 eggs, a glob of real mayo, a half-cup of chopped celery, a splash of dijon mustard, salt & pepper and mixed it all up for egg salad. It was kind of blah. How do you guys make egg salad more zingy? For someone who mostly used to eat out, I'm a really BAD cook.

Default Re: Egg Salad Blahs

I sometimes add a little chopped pickle or relish. (Dill only no sugar added). A few drops of hot sauce will give it a little kick. Scoop it up with pork rinds for a little more flavor.
I also like tuna/egg salad. Just mix both. Its a little less blah

Default Re: Egg Salad Blahs

Yep...try mustard and dill relish and some Louisiana hot sauce. The mustard will make a huge difference.

My basic ingredients for tuna salad, shredded chicken, or devilled eggs:

mayo
mustard
dill relish
greeen onion
celery
salt
pepper
optional:
Louisiana hot sauce
fresh jalapeno

Just mix 'em up until you get the "right" consistency and flavor for the way you like yours.

Default Re: Egg Salad Blahs

I'm with Hopeful on this. A little bit of vinegar or lemon juice brightens the flavor of egg salad, tuna salad, chicken salad, etc.

One of my favorite veggie dip is mayo, mixed with a little lemon juice or vinegar and a bit of onion powder. It's great with artichokes, raw snow peas, bell peppers, cucumbers etc.
